The German Gymnastics Team at the World Championships in Antwerp – Olympic qualification for the men’s team

The World Artistic Gymnastics Championships are currently taking place in Antwerp, Belgium. From 30 September to 8 October 2023, the national elite of the German Gymnastics Federation will compete with the best athletes in the world. Moreover, qualification for the 2024 Olympic Games in Paris is also at stake.

The German men’s gymnastics team has already secured its ticket for Paris. Valeri Belenki’s team achieved a strong fifth place in the team qualifiers on Saturday and Sunday, which not only qualifies them for the Olympics but also means participation in the World Cup team final on Tuesday. In addition to this, Lukas Dauser and Nils Dunkel reached three individual finals. Lukas will compete in the all-around as well as the parallel bars final (as best on points) and Nils will fight for World Championship medals in the pommel horse final.

Füchse Berlin win confidently and remain unbeaten

In their third home match of the season, Füchse did not show any weakness on Sunday (01.10.2023) and deservedly beat the promoted ThSV Eisenach 37:29 (20:13) in the sold-out Max-Schmeling-Halle (9,000 spectators). The Scandinavian trio of Mathias Gidsel (9), Lasse Andersson (8) and Hans Lindberg (7/1) were particularly brilliant. With their seventh win in a row, the Berliners remain level on points with MT Melsungen at the top of the table.

Another pleasing side note from the game: In the 59th minute, Max Günther, a home-grown player in this debut game in the LIQUI MOLY HBL, scored from 7 metres to make it 37:28. With the debutant, Tim Freihöfer, Matthes Langhoff, Nils Lichtlein, Max Beneke and Keno Jacobs, six players from our own academy were on the pitch in the closing seconds – historic!

After yesterday’s Bundesliga match against Eisenach, the Füchse are putting all their focus on HC Erlangen. The duel in the round of 16 of the DHB Cup is scheduled for Tuesday (3.10., 4.30 pm), and only four days later both teams will meet in the league (Saturday, 7.10.,5.30 pm).

1st FC Saarbrücken Table Tennis still in the Cup and undefeated in the TTBL

On Friday evening (29 October 2023) the 1st FC Saarbrücken Table Tennis took a convincing place in the quarter-finals of the German Cup 2023/2024. The reigning Champions League winners won by a clear 3-0 margin against second-division team TTC OE Bad Homburg.

Thanks to two individual victories by Darko Jorgić and another win by Cedric Meissner, the 1st FCS Table Tennis team won their second home match of the season in the German Table Tennis League (TTBL) on Sunday (01.10.2023) against Post SV Mühlhausen. This means that they remain unbeaten after the fifth match day with long-time rivals Borussia Düsseldorf at the top of the table.

For the Saarbrücken team, the Bundesliga continues on 16 October with the seventh match of the season.

Saarlouis Royals start Bundesliga season with a loss

On Saturday evening (30 October 2023), the Saarlouis Royals started the new season 2023/24 of the1st division of the Bundesliga for women’s basketball. It was a game full of twists and turns! The Royals fought back impressively after a half-time score of 17:30 for the Berliners. In the last quarter, they even managed to switch the lead, but the guests kept their nerve. Despite a strong performance by the Saarlouis women’s basketball team, the victory went to the Berliners.

The next league game for the Royals and the chance to “fix the start” is already on the horizon. On German Unification Day (3.10.), the women’s basketball team from the Saarland will face the Eisvögel USC Freiburg in an away game.

proWIN Volleys with home defeat

Unfortunately, the women’s volleyball team of TV Holz e.V. were unable to win anything against the women of SV Karlsruhe-Beiertheim at their home match in the multifunctional hall at the Herrmann-Neuberger-Sportschule in Saarbrücken on Saturday evening (30 September 2023). In the second home match of the relatively new season in the 2nd division of the Women’s Volleyball Bundesliga, the proWIN Volleys were unable to continue their strong performance from the first set they won, so in the end they were defeated 3:1. The next opportunity for the young team to do better will be at the away game on 14 October at TV Planegg-Kraillingen.

Gabriel Clemens back from the Players Championships and on to the World Grand Prix 2023

Barnsley, in England, hosted three more Pro Tour tournaments in the Players Championship Series from Wednesday, 27 September to Friday, 29 September 2023. Things didn’t go quite right for Saarland darts pro Gabriel Clemens over the three days.

On the first day, the German number one started the tournament with a stunning 6:1 win over James Wilson, but in round two he lost 6:2 to Ian White. On Thursday, a compatriot stopped the German Giant already in the second round. Pascal Rupprecht prevailed against Clemens with a 6:2 score. Before that GAGA managed a whitewash against Alan Soutar. On the third day of the Players Championships, it was already the end of the line for the German No. 1 in the first round. In his first duel on Friday Gabriel Clemens was defeated 4:6 by Mervyn King.

The World Grand Prix 2023 in Leicester offers the German Giant the next opportunity to compete in a major tournament. The World Grand Prix sees darts’ biggest stars compete in a very special tournament. It is the only Major tournament of the PDC that is played in “double-in-double-out” mode. In what is known as DIDO, players must both start and finish the leg with a double. Right at the start Gabriel Clemens will meet the former World Champion Peter Wright on Tuesday (3 October 2023) from about 10 pm.
